    To manufacture anhydrous sodium acetate industrially, the Niacet Process is used. Sodium metal ingots are extruded through a die to form a ribbon of sodium metal, usually under an inert gas atmosphere such as N 2 then immersed in anhydrous acetic acid. 2 CH 3 COOH + 2 Na →2 CH 3 COONa + H 2. The hydrogen gas is normally a valuable byproduct.
